Job description

 Responsibilities:

- Proactively identifies opportunities for financial, operational, and delivery performance enhancement.

- Spearheads the successful implementation of our product and service suite with new and existing clients, driving exceptional business and financial outcomes through RCM transformation.

-Partner closely with our technology teams to deploy & implement our suite of products/workflow engines to drive best operational outcomes.

- Analyze business metrics trends, potential issues & escalations, client feedback & business strategy

 

Essential:

- 7+ years of experience in acute operations management and management consulting or advisory services.

- 5+ years of revenue cycle experience including Patient Access and Billing.

- Proven record of accomplishment of managing large-scale parallel transitions.

- Expertise in leading revenue cycle assessments, system implementations, and operations.

 -Expertise in revenue workflow optimization and/or performance improvement.

-Willingness and ability to travel as required.

-Master’s degree in business or healthcare, such as MBA, MHA, or MPH

 

Compensation and Benefits: The base salary range for this position is $175k-$215k. Pay is based on several factors, including but not limited to current market conditions, location, education, work experience, certifications, etc. IKS Health offers a competitive benefits package, including healthcare, 401k, and paid time off (all benefits are subject to eligibility requirements for full-time employees).
